Zend_Amf& addDirectory()vs setClass()

时间:2010-08-05 19:47:57

标签: zend-framework amf zend-amf

Zend_Amf的addDirectory()是否有其他人遇到问题?

它应该自动加载服务类,似乎不是。虽然它适用于setClass就好了。请参阅下面的代码段。

我在ZF 1.8上看到了有这样一个bug的olders帖子。这个错误是否仍然存在或我遗失了什么?

我正常启动服务器,如下所示:

失败

$server = new Zend_Amf_Server();
$server->addDirectory(APPLICATION_PATH . '/services/');
echo $server->handle();

WORKS

$server = new Zend_Amf_Server();
$server->setClass('MyAmfService');
echo $server->handle();

感谢任何帮助

谢谢!

1 个答案:

答案 0 :(得分:1)

回答我自己的问题 - 看起来路径很挑剔。我在Windows的盒子上,正在改变

$ server-> addDirectory(APPLICATION_PATH。'/ services /');

$ server-> addDirectory(APPLICATION_PATH。'\ services \');

做了这个伎俩